Traditional digital health models Most developed countries have moved away from paper-based healthcare solutions and have adopted or are in the process of adopting ‘traditional’ digital healthcare models (see Figure 4). For example, in Singapore, the National Electronic Health Record (NEHR) system was rolled out in 2011.
